Case Study - Plataforma BIM/CAD para Diseno de Sistemas de Proteccion Contra Rayos
Plataforma cloud-native para analisis BIM/CAD que automatiza el diseno 3D de sistemas de proteccion contra rayos (SPCA), asegurando cumplimiento normativo IEC 62305/NTC 4552 y reduciendo el tiempo de calculo de dias a minutos.
- Client
- Bolt Architecture
- Year
- Service
- Computational Geometry Platform

Descripcion general
Bolt Architecture es una plataforma cloud-native de analisis BIM/CAD que transforma el diseno de sistemas de proteccion contra rayos (SPCA) en un flujo de trabajo de geometria computacional.
Desarrollada en marzo de 2026, la solucion aborda uno de los problemas mas criticos en ingenieria electrica: el diseno de proteccion contra rayos para edificaciones complejas sigue siendo un proceso manual, propenso a errores y bidimensional.
En Colombia, el Articulo 15 del RETIE y la norma tecnica NTC 4552 exigen SPCA para todos los edificios publicos, hospitales e instalaciones industriales. Bolt Architecture automatiza este cumplimiento normativo con precision milimetrica 3D.
El desafio tecnico
Construir una plataforma de geometria computacional para proteccion contra rayos presento desafios complejos:
-
Complejidad geometrica: Procesar modelos BIM de 150-500MB (IFC/DWG/DXF) con millones de triangulos para calculos booleanos precisos.
-
Metodo de la Esfera Rodante: Implementar el algoritmo de proteccion mediante operaciones booleanas 3D (Trimesh + Manifold3D) que simulan el radio de impacto de una descarga electrica.
-
Visualizacion en tiempo real: Renderizar modelos 3D masivos en navegador con React Three Fiber + WebGL para presentaciones instantaneas a clientes e inspectores.
-
Cumplimiento normativo: Generar informes automaticos formateados segun NTC 4552-2 para inspeccion ONAC con trazabilidad completa.
-
Procesamiento asincrono: Ejecutar calculos de colision KD-Tree y operaciones booleanas en workers Celery sin bloquear la interfaz de usuario.
Lo que hicimos
- Computational Geometry
- BIM/CAD Integration
- 3D Boolean Operations
- WebGL Visualization
- FastAPI + Celery
- RETIE Compliance
Knot Software Factory transformo nuestro concepto de diseno SPCA en una plataforma computacional de clase mundial. La precision geometrica 3D y la generacion automatica de informes RETIE nos posicionan como lideres en cumplimiento normativo.

Equipo de Desarrollo
- Modelos BIM soportados
- 500MB
- Operaciones booleanas
- 45s
- Visualizacion WebGL
- 60 FPS
- Cumplimiento RETIE
- 100%
Capacidades Core
Importacion Nativa BIM
- Formatos soportados: IFC 2x3/4, OBJ, DXF, DWG (via conversor Teigha)
- Tamano maximo: 150-500MB por modelo
- Procesamiento: Parsing asincrono con progreso visual
Metodo de la Esfera Rodante
- Geometria 3D precisa: Trimesh + Manifold3D para operaciones booleanas
- Radio variable: Configurable segun nivel de proteccion (20m, 45m, 60m)
- Calculo de volumenes: Identificacion automatica de zonas no protegidas
- Colision optimizada: KD-Tree para deteccion eficiente de intersecciones
Visualizacion 3D en Tiempo Real
- Motor: React Three Fiber (R3F) sobre Three.js
- Renderizado: WebGL con 60 FPS en GPUs de gama media
- Interaccion: Colocacion interactiva de esferas de proteccion
- Preview: Vista previa en tiempo real del diseno
Motor de Evaluacion de Riesgo
- Workers asincronos: Celery + Redis para procesamiento sin bloqueo
- Normativa aplicada: NTC 4552-2 (Colombia), IEC 62305 (Internacional)
- Generacion de informes: PDF con ReportLab + trazabilidad auditada
- Exportacion: DXF (ezdxf) para integracion con CAD
Arquitectura Tecnica
Frontend (React + R3F)
| Componente | Tecnologia |
|---|---|
| Visualizador 3D | React Three Fiber + Three.js |
| UI de colocacion | Controles esfericos interactivos |
| Upload | MinIO con URLs prefirmadas |
| Preview export | Previsualizacion PDF/DXF |
| Estado | Zustand |
| Routing | React Router |
| HTTP | Axios |
Backend (FastAPI + Celery)
| Componente | Tecnologia |
|---|---|
| API Gateway | FastAPI (async) |
| Motor de riesgo | Async Celery workers |
| Geometria booleana | Trimesh + Manifold3D |
| Logging auditoria | RETIE traceability |
| Queue | Redis + Celery |
| Storage | MinIO (S3-compatible) |
| Database | PostgreSQL + Alembic |
Stack de Geometria Computacional
Trimesh - Manipulacion de mallas triangulares
Manifold3D - Operaciones booleanas solidas
Scikit-spatial - Calculos geometricos espaciales
R3F - Renderizado 3D React
Three.js - Motor WebGL subyacente
Infraestructura y Deployment
Especificaciones de Hardware
- Procesamiento: 4-8 vCPU, 16GB RAM (no requiere GPU)
- Escalado: Workers Celery procesan mallas asincronamente
- Deployment: Docker Compose (dev) / Kubernetes (prod)
Performance Benchmarks
| Metrica | Valor |
|---|---|
| Upload + parse 150MB IFC | < 30 segundos |
| Malla 300k triangulos | < 45 segundos operacion booleana |
| Preview esfera en tiempo real | 60 FPS |
| Generacion informe PDF | < 10 segundos |
Cumplimiento Normativo
IEC 62305 - Proteccion Contra Rayos (Internacional)
- IEC 62305-1: Principios generales
- IEC 62305-2: Evaluacion de riesgo
- IEC 62305-3: Proteccion de estructuras fisicas
- IEC 62305-4: Proteccion de sistemas electricos
NTC 4552 - Norma Tecnica Colombiana
- NTC 4552-1: Requisitos generales
- NTC 4552-2: Evaluacion de riesgo de rayo
- NTC 4552-3: Proteccion de estructuras
- NTC 4552-4: Sistemas de proteccion interna
RETIE - Reglamento Tecnico de Instalaciones Electricas (Colombia)
- Articulo 15: Exige SPCA para edificios publicos, hospitales e industriales
- Trazabilidad: Logs de auditoria inmutables para inspeccion ONAC
Modelo de Negocio SaaS
Streams de Ingreso
-
Suscripcion SaaS - Por volumen de proyectos
- Starter: $49/mes (5 proyectos)
- Profesional: $149/mes (ilimitado)
- Enterprise: Custom (API, SSO)
-
Licencia por Proyecto - Usuarios ocasionales
- $25/proyecto con acceso 30 dias
-
Add-on Certificacion - Exportes formato ONAC
- $15/informe con firma digital
Oportunidad de Mercado
| Metrica | Valor |
|---|---|
| TAM | $2.1B mercado global proteccion contra rayos (2024) |
| SAM | $180M mercado software ingenieria Latinoamerica |
| SOM | $12M mercado software cumplimiento Colombia |
Roadmap de Producto
| Fase | Timeline | Entregable |
|---|---|---|
| MVP | Marzo 2026 | Esfera Rodante + Evaluacion riesgo |
| Fase 2 | Q2 2026 | Metodo Angulo Proteccion + Malla |
| Fase 3 | Q3 2026 | Soporte ESE (Emisor de Streamer Temprano) |
| Fase 4 | Q4 2026 | Optimizacion IA de colocacion |
Estado Actual (MVP Live)
- Infraestructura Dockerizada (PostgreSQL, Redis, MinIO, FastAPI, Celery)
- Upload y visualizacion 3D de modelos IFC
- Implementacion Metodo de la Esfera Rodante
- Modulo de evaluacion de riesgo (NTC 4552-2)
- Autenticacion de usuarios (roles admin/ingeniero)
- Deployment produccion con SSL (subdominio digelec.com.co)
Valor Entregado
| Valor Tecnico | Valor de Negocio |
|---|---|
| Geometria 3D precisa via operaciones booleanas | Reduccion de 2-3 dias a minutos en analisis SPCA |
| Visualizacion WebGL en tiempo real | Presentaciones instantaneas a clientes e inspectores |
| Calculo automatizado NTC 4552 | Cumplimiento normativo sin errores humanos |
| Informes ONAC auditables | Trazabilidad completa para inspeccion regulatoria |
| Plataforma cloud-native escalable | Acceso desde cualquier dispositivo, sin instalacion |
Estado: MVP operativo en produccion con clientes pilotos en Colombia, procesando modelos BIM reales para diseno de proteccion contra rayos certificable.

